Villas at Tustin

Santa Ana, CA


Villas at Tustin

Address

2414 North Tustin
Santa Ana, CA 92705
Overall Rating
Met My Needs
Overall value
Service Quality
0% 0 out of 0 renters
recommend this apartment.

Recently Viewed

Waterford Square
650 Waterford Drive
Florissant, MO 63033
PPC Siena LLC
7375 Rollingdell Dr
Cupertino, CA 95014
Highland Square
299 W Mingus Ave
Cottonwood, AZ 86326
La Estrella Vista
3065 N 67th Ave
Phoenix, AZ 85033

Reviews

 
No reviews found.